Uttarakhand Civil Judge recruitment 2023: Overview
Name of the Recruitment | UKPSC Civil Judge |
Authority | Uttarakhand Public Service Commission or UKPSC |
Division | Junior |
Department | Uttarakhand Judicial Service |
Year | 2023 |
Post | Civil Judge |
Group of the Post | B |
Number of Vacancies | 16 |
Notification Number | 10@DR/E-2/ |
Notification Release Date | 1st March 2023 |
Application Mode | Online |
Last Date to Apply | 21 March 2023 |
Examination Levels | Screening Test and Mains Examination |
Examination Date | 30th April 2023 |

S.No. | Category | Posts for Male Candidates | Posts for Female Candidates | Total |
1. | Unreserved or General or UR | 5 | 2 | 7 |
2. | Scheduled Castes or SC | 3 | 1 | 4 |
3. | Scheduled Tribes or ST | 1 | 0 | 1 |
4. | Other Backward Classes or OBC | 2 | 1 | 3 |
5. | Economically Weaker Section or EWS | 1 | 0 | 1 |
Total | 12 | 4 | 16 |
Nationality of the Candidates
The candidates with any of the following Nationality conditions will be allowed to apply for the notified vacancies:
- The candidate is an Indian by Nationality.
- The candidate is a Tibetan Refugee living in India before 1962 and has decided to settle permanently.
- Applicant is of Indian origin and has migrated from any of the following countries:
- Pakistan
- Sri Lanka
- Mayanmar
- East Africa
- Uganda
- United Republic of Tanzania

Civil Judge Educational Qualification
The following educational qualifications are required in the candidates who will apply for the post of Civil Judge under the Uttarakhand Public Service Commission:
- The candidate must have pursued Law from a recognised university in Uttarakhand.
- Candidates who have completed their Law from Educational Institutions acknowledged by the Governer established outside Uttarakhand can also apply for the post.
- The applicant must have at least finished Bachelors in Law.
- Basic Knowledge of Computers is expected from the aspiring candidates.
- The applicants must also be very proficient in Hindi or Devnagri Script.
UK Civil Judge Age Criteria and Age Relaxations
The candidates can be a minimum of 22 Years of age while applying for the posts. There will be no relaxation or special allowance provided in the lower age limit to any candidate. The upper age limit is 35 Years. However, candidates belonging to certain candidates can enjoy age relaxation as per the norms of the Uttarakhand Government.

UKPSC Civil Judge Examination Pattern
There will be two levels of examination that will be conducted in order to recruit Civil Judges. The candidates will have to go through an initial preliminary Screening Test that will be objective type. The candidates who will pass the exam will be appearing for the Mains exam and Viva Voice Examination or Interview. The following Scheme will be followed by the Uttarakhand Public Service Commission while conducting these exams:
S.No. | Level of Examination | Part | Subject | Marks |
1. | Preliminary | I | General Knowledge | 50 |
II | Acts and Laws | 150 | ||
Total | 200 | |||
2. | Mains | I | The Present Day | 150 |
II | Language | 100 | ||
III | Law: Paper-I – Substantive Law | 200 | ||
IV | Law: Paper-II – Evidence and Procedure | 200 | ||
V | Law: Paper-III – Revenue and Criminal | 200 | ||
VI | For Basic Knowledge of computer Operation Practical Examination | 100 | ||
VII | Viva-Voice | 100 | ||
Total | 1050 |
